Adventures in Babysitting is the twenty-second episode of the fourth season in this television sitcom on Step by Step, which was aired on ABC on May 5, 1995. It was directed by Patrick Duffy and written by Maria A. Brown.

Summary[]

Frank is pleased enough with Cody's construction work, actually bright compared to Dave, to promote his cool cousin to foreman, but Cody has the natural boss-authority of a doormat, and gets ordered to fire inept well-meaning newbie Dave, who doesn't stop at sob stories... When dad Frank refuses to finance Al's $500 Disneyland trip, J.T. decides to earn the money together by babysitting, over ten kids simultaneously. The cocky first boy is a challenge, the second- bus-load a nightmares subscription with demolition option... Meanwhile Karen demonstrates that spending money -on a prom dress- can be even slower and more tiring for pregnant ma Carol...

Trivia[]

  • Adventures in Babysitting (1987) was the source for the title.
  • This is Scarlett Pomers' TV debut.
